Transaction 57b05b03159bd44dfe00a40ff762d0712c1536e13b0528b7b3b1925cd30dbd36
1 Input
2 Outputs
- 57b05b03159bd44dfe00a40ff762d0712c1536e13b0528b7b3b1925cd30dbd36:0
- 57b05b03159bd44dfe00a40ff762d0712c1536e13b0528b7b3b1925cd30dbd36:1
value 728866
address 38koNhSfhHMz6BsmiLrpNcetiPxVbXHiP9
value 10461527991
address 1CW4akQDsrrVH9F5BeMaMN5xxeqTrDWEvy